The mayor of Viana do Castelo guaranteed today that the municipality will pay, in 2023, double what it received from the Government under public transport support programs.

“Of the money guaranteed to us for 2023, we only received 600 thousand euros and we have already paid twice as much, around 1.2 million euros, to the operators. We are making an additional effort in a commitment that the Government decided, and rightly so, to subsidize transport. I cannot create more pressure on the Chamber’s finances by anticipating more than I anticipated”, stated Luís Nobre.

The mayor was referring to the compensations granted by the State within the scope of the Support Program for Fare Reduction in Public Transport (PART) and the Support Program for the Densification and Reinforcement of the Public Transport Offer (PROTransP).

The issue was raised today by the CDU councilor, Cláudia Marinho, in the period before the agenda of the council meeting, with the remaining opposition, the independent Eduardo Teixeira, Paulo Vale, from the PSD, and Hugo Meira, from the CDS-PP, requesting explanations on the matter following a statement from the AVIC group sent to all members of the municipal executive.

In the document, to which Lusa had access, the group, which includes the companies Transcunha – Transportes Rodoviários de Viana, Auto Viação do Minho and António dos Prazeres da Silva & Filho, announces the suspension of discounts on fares for social passes and transport tickets road transport on urban and interurban lines in Viana do Castelo, citing a debt owed by the municipality of 530 thousand euros.

Of that amount, 280 thousand euros relate to 2023 and 250 thousand to 2024.

At the end of the chamber meeting, Luís Nobre explained to journalists that the municipality has not yet received the money for the last three months of 2023 and the amounts identified for 2024 cannot be transferred because the operators have not signed the new contracts.

Until 2023, subsidies were granted under PART and ProTransp and, from 2024, under Incentiva + PT.

“In the past, compensation for each bus leaving the garage was 250 euros, per day, up to 150 kilometers. From 2024, what was proposed to operators was 285 euros for up to 150 kilometers. There were operators who accepted and operators who did not sign the contract because they wanted a value of 318 euros. There are no resources for that. I can’t take on resources I don’t have,” he explained.

The socialist mayor said that “all decisions related to public transport have been made by the Intermunicipal Community (CIM) of Alto Minho and, in solidarity, between the municipalities and each other”.

“This is compensation, it is not a requested service. It is a sum included in the State Budget, which is transferred to the CIM of Alto Minho and which is divided among the municipalities that make up the structure. From then on, each municipality is responsible for delivering the respective contribution to the operators”, he specified.

Luís Nobre said that, in view of the suspension, by the AVIC group, of discounts on tariffs for social passes and road transport tickets on urban and interurban lines in the municipality, he issued an order that determines that “in situations in which operators refuse to guarantee reducing the cost of tickets, users can go to the municipality to receive reimbursement”.
